Specification | Samsung Galaxy Pocket S5300 | Xiaomi Redmi 7 Pro |
---|---|---|
CPU | 832 MHz, Single Core Processor | 2 GHz, Octa Core Processor |
OS | Android v2.3.6 (Gingerbread) | Android v9.0 (Pie) |
Battery | 1200 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 4000 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
Display | 2.8 inches, 240 x 320 pixels | 5.84 inches, 1440 x 720 pixels |
Rear Camera | 2 MP | 12 MP + 5 MP with autofocus |
Price | ₹4,999 | ₹10,999 |
